Innovative Potato Towers Recipe

  • Total Time: 1 hour 20 minutes
  • Yield: 5 1x

Ingredients

  • 2 lbs (907 g) Yukon gold potatoes, peeled or unpeeled
  • ½ cup (120 g) Gruyere cheese, shredded
  • 1 ½ cups (360 ml) heavy cream
  • 1 clove garlic, grated
  • 1 tsp coarse salt
  • ¼ tsp black pepper
  • 1 tsp dried dill weed

Instructions

  1. Preheat Preparation: Warm the oven to 350°F and thoroughly spray a 12-cup muffin tin with nonstick cooking spray to prevent sticking.
  2. Potato Slicing: Use a mandolin to create uniform, translucent potato rounds, ensuring consistent thickness for even cooking and layering.
  3. Flavor Infusion: Combine potato slices with heavy cream, garlic, dried dill, and seasonings in a large mixing bowl, thoroughly coating each slice with the aromatic mixture.
  4. Tower Construction: Carefully layer potato slices into each muffin cavity, pressing down gently to compact the layers and fill almost to the rim, then drizzle remaining cream mixture over the top.
  5. Initial Baking: Cover the muffin tin with aluminum foil and bake for 40 minutes, allowing potatoes to steam and develop a tender, melt-in-your-mouth interior.
  6. Cheese Finishing: Remove foil, sprinkle Gruyere cheese generously over each potato stack, and return to the oven for an additional 20 minutes until cheese transforms into a golden, crispy crust.
  7. Serving Technique: Allow potato towers to cool briefly, then carefully loosen edges with a thin spatula and transfer to serving plates, presenting these elegant culinary creations immediately.

Notes

  • Slice Precisely: Use a mandolin for ultra-thin, uniform potato rounds to guarantee even cooking and elegant tower structure.
  • Cream Coating Technique: Thoroughly toss potato slices in cream mixture to ensure each layer absorbs maximum flavor and moisture.
  • Layering Strategy: Pack potato slices tightly in muffin cups, pressing down gently to create compact, structured towers that hold their shape.
  • Cheese Topping Tip: Wait until final baking stage to add Gruyere, allowing it to melt and create a crispy, golden-brown crown that elevates the entire dish.
